Sailed Disney Magic in 1998 but hadn't been on a cruise since. I finally convinced my DH to go on a Disney Cruise. After he huffed and puffed about how we could go on a cheaper cruise, I showed him the DVD and he was somewhat sold. Well, he was completely sold when we sailed March 18 - 22, 2012 on Disney Dream. We were celebrating our birthdays. I can't tell people enough how fantastic the trip was. It was just us two and we can be spokespeople on how the Disney cruises aren't just for children!

Palo was magnificent! Our server Corinne gave great recommendations and made sure all our needs were met for that dining experience. She was very friendly and seemed to love her job. The only downside was our main server was horrible! No recommendations, told me "no" or "I don't know" to everything I asked. I finally had to say something to guest services and he became a completely different person after that. I had to convince the DH to tip him, he was that bad. The assistant server was much better, friendly, engaging, and funny.

Our room was always cleaned even if we were gone for five minutes, our stateroom would have been fixed up within that time! The Atlantis excursion was delightful though it was kind of long but the Atlantis hotel is gorgeous. We went to shows, we rode bikes on the island, we ate and ate and ate! We rode the AquaDuck several times with my DH scaring kids telling them it was fast. It's not. The DH has vowed to never use another cruise line. He loved it so much! I'm not sure what else to say that hasn't been said already by others.

Forgot to add, he liked it so much we signed up for the 7-Night Eastern Caribbean on Disney Fantasy for March 2013! Excited!
